A Certificate Programme in Social Engineering Security equips participants with the skills to recognize and mitigate social engineering attacks. The program focuses on practical application and real-world scenarios, developing crucial cybersecurity awareness.
Learning outcomes include understanding various social engineering techniques (like phishing, baiting, pretexting), identifying vulnerabilities, developing security awareness training programs, and implementing countermeasures. Students will learn to analyze attack vectors and design robust security protocols to prevent successful social engineering exploits.
